Overview of this book

In the competitive data-centric world, mastering data stewardship is not just a requirement—it's the key to organizational success. Unlock strategic excellence with Data Stewardship in Action, your guide to exploring the intricacies of data stewardship and its implementation for maximum efficiency. From business strategy to data strategy, and then to data stewardship, this book shows you how to strategically deploy your workforce, processes, and technology for efficient data processing. You’ll gain mastery over the fundamentals of data stewardship, from understanding the different roles and responsibilities to implementing best practices for data governance. You’ll elevate your data management skills by exploring the technologies and tools for effective data handling. As you progress through the chapters, you’ll realize that this book not only helps you develop the foundational skills to become a successful data steward but also introduces innovative approaches, including leveraging AI and GPT, for enhanced data stewardship. By the end of this book, you’ll be able to build a robust data governance framework by developing policies and procedures, establishing a dedicated data governance team, and creating a data governance roadmap that ensures your organization thrives in the dynamic landscape of data management.

Summary

Overall, this chapter provided a comprehensive overview of the roles and responsibilities of data stewards, as well as related topics such as data quality management, data lineage, data classification, access control, data security, and data privacy and compliance.

Data stewards bridge the gap between data governance policy-making bodies and the implementation of data policies. Some of their key responsibilities include reconciling conflicting definitions, defining value domains, reporting on quality metrics, establishing data access control and security, monitoring and ensuring compliance with regulations, providing data-driven insights, and more.
